Eiffage SA, a hallmark in the realm of European construction, thrives on its multifaceted prowess in the industry, stretching its influence across sectors such as construction, infrastructure, energy systems, and concessions. Founded in 1993 through a strategic merger, Eiffage has carved a prestigious reputation by executing some of the continent’s most ambitious projects. The company's operations are as varied as they are vast, encompassing the design, construction, and maintenance of buildings and infrastructures like roads, railways, and bridges. It also excels in energy systems and facilities management, providing an integrated suite of services that underpin its robust revenue streams. This diversification allows Eiffage not only to scale its operations but also to effectively hedge risks inherent in the construction industry, where cyclical economic trends can often dictate the rhythm of business. Fundamentally, Eiffage's financial engine is powered by its concessions division, which operates toll roads and public-private partnerships, generating long-term, stable income. The company owns and manages numerous concessions, such as highways and transport infrastructures, which, over time, have become critical revenue pillars, balancing the sometimes volatile nature of construction projects. What is Eiffage SA's Total Current Liabilities?
Total Current Liabilities
17.6B EUR

Based on the financial report for Jun 30, 2025, Eiffage SA's Total Current Liabilities amounts to 17.6B EUR.

What is Eiffage SA's Total Current Liabilities growth rate?
Total Current Liabilities CAGR 10Y
6%

Over the last year, the Total Current Liabilities growth was 12%. The average annual Total Current Liabilities growth rates for Eiffage SA have been 10% over the past three years , 7% over the past five years , and 6% over the past ten years .
